Output 58329513a6576ed5de6d246c40f83bb768ea1b08d4f584c2b80dfeafa1da6e7b:105

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d1bd5cec84bcd60ed845661d0e2f05aaec35f088fc8a0e2937a9d7cef451483
address
tb1p85datnkgf0xkpmvy2esapchst2hvxhcg3ly2pc5n02whem69zjps4gyjlr
transaction
58329513a6576ed5de6d246c40f83bb768ea1b08d4f584c2b80dfeafa1da6e7b
confirmations
9501
spent
true